Meet Emmet—a musical illustration brought to life by The Music Executives, through a vibrant fusion of stunning art, captivating musical arrangements, fresh original compositions, and dynamic dance. It’s an unforgettable journey of self-discovery and artistic expression!
“Emmet – The Resue” is the thrilling third chapter in a five-part saga. Set in the early 1900s with rich medieval themes, it follows the journey of ENOSH, a man seeking PURPOSE in his life, discovers through a vision that his long-lost master, SIJUADE, is alive and being held prisoner in the city of the BULLS OF BASHAN. Enosh must choose between the life he has built with his love, ADIJA, and his destiny to rescue his master.
- Acts One & Two (Infiltration & The City of The Bulls): Enosh and his comrades infiltrate the heavily fortified city of the Bulls of Bashan by disguising themselves as jewelry merchants. They successfully navigate strict, two-part security checkpoints by using clever distractions to hide their weapons and personnel. The city is established as a disciplined, militant fortress with imposing sandstone walls, specialized training grounds, and a fortified, grim prison.
- Acts Three & Four (The Market & Royal Festival): While in the market square, Enosh maintains his cover, avoiding unnecessary conflict to focus on his mission. A royal announcement declares that King Og is celebrating his 23rd coronation anniversary, an event that will feature grand spectacles and the execution of a high-profile prisoner (Sijuade). The acts conclude with royal banquet celebrations featuring various dance performances.
- Act Five (The Rescue Plan): The team gathers to finalize their rescue mission, reviewing guard rotations and checkpoints. Simultaneously, Adija and the wives of the comrades provide emotional support to one another while awaiting news. Sijuade, inside his cell, remains faithful and expectant, sensing that his rescue is near.
- Act Six (The Prison Break & Escape): At dawn, the team executes the rescue. They encounter heavy resistance and are forced to navigate through marshes, walls, and guards. They successfully infiltrate the prison and free Sijuade, though one comrade is lost during the battle. As they flee, Sijuade is wounded, but they manage to escape the city under the cover of the morning mist and the distraction of a makeshift blockade.
- Act Seven (Finale): Sijuade passes away in Enosh’s arms, imparting final wisdom about forgiveness, love, and steadfastness before he dies. The script concludes with a depiction of Sijuade’s transition into a celestial paradise, where he is guided through golden gates by spiritual guardians to find eternal peace.
